Trails galore!

Mountain Bike Trail (3.5 miles) - This trail begins at the Lake Rebecca rental building. Most of the trail winds through old fields and remnant maple-basswood forest. The trail passes an overlook of the swan refuge pond where birds can regularly be seen.

Paved Bike/Hike Trail (6.5 miles) - This trail is a single loop through the park with rolling hills and scenic views. There are rest stops along the trail. This trail serves as a connection to the north edge of the park reserve.

Turf hiking trail (3.9 miles) - In addition to the paved trail, these turf trails are self-guided nature trails through hills, prairie marsh and upland woodlands. A map is available at the rental building.

Horse Trails (9.8 miles) - Lake Rebecca offers scenic trails for horseback riders. Trailer parking is available. User fees apply for each horse and rider age 16 or older. Three Rivers Park District does not rent horses.

For a complete trail map, visit ThreeRiversParks.org
---------------------------------------------------------
River Access - There is an access point for canoes onto the Crow River in the southwest corner of the park on County Road 50.

Play Area - Newly renovated, the Lake Rebecca play area has a “Big Woods” theme featuring components such as a tree house, several ground climbers, and slides fabricated to look like fallen trees and roots

Fishing - For tiger muskies, largemouth bass, walleyes and pan fish are available in Lake Rebecca. There are two accessible fishing piers along the shores, with one located in the bay and the other near the swimming beach for shore fishing.

Pets in the Park - Pets are allowed at group camp areas; however, pets are not allowed in picnic areas, beach areas or play areas. Pets are allowed on paved trails at Lake Rebecca Park Reserve, but they are not permitted on turf trails. Pets must be attended at all times and on a maximum of a 6-foot leash.
